How Polymer Grade Propylene is Priced

Do you understand how the pricing of polymer grade propylene is critical to the supply chain?

Propylene, particularly PGP, play an integral part in the costs that trickle downstream and spread throughout the refining, petrochemical and broader manufacturing industry. If you don’t fully understand the pricing method by which you are buying or selling PGP, you could be selling too low, or buying too high.

Infographic: Major Reasons U.S. West Coast Fuel Prices are Volatile

What makes the U.S. West Coast spot gasoline and diesel market so prone to dramatic price increases and changes?

Because of unique market fundamentals, limited refining capacity, and a boutique gasoline blend needed to meet regional specs, the West Coast region has a relatively lean gas and diesel trading network compared to other spot markets. That lack of market liquidity can lead to huge price moves and surges, like the one that caused retail gasoline prices to top over $4/gal in spring 2019.
